Runbook: Snackline restock planner stalls.

Symptom: planner job exceeds 20 min, machines show stale inventory.

1. Check the planner queue depth; over 500 means a stuck solver.
2. Restart the solver pod; do not restart the ingest pod.
3. Verify route output regenerates within 5 min.
4. If machines in the Larkfield region still show stale counts, flush the region cache.

Full escalation matrix is on the page below.

runbook for badug-kadup: https://confluence.zemvarlabs.internal/projects/browse/display/projects/bd1b

14:22 — Offline sync regression confirmed (Terrapath field-survey app)

At 14:22 the on-call engineer reproduced the data-loss path: surveys saved while offline were marked synced once connectivity returned, even when the upload was rejected. The queue flush skipped the server acknowledgement check introduced in the previous sprint. Release manager note: the fix must ship before the coastal survey season. The offending build is identified by the token recorded below.

session token of kawif-fawig = htk31_f3f599be2b1a34affb1efa8d0feccf8

Subject: DeployBeacon cut-over complete

Hi plugin authors,

The cut-over of DeployBeacon, our deploy-status chat bot, finished last night without incident. All channels now route through the new Larkspur gateway, and legacy webhooks were retired at midnight. Please verify your plugins reconnect cleanly and re-register any custom commands. To update your local manifests, use the configuration values listed below.

settings of tagef-bawif:
DRUIX_HOST=druix.zemvarlabs.internal
DRUIX_PORT=8000

### Action Item: Spoolhaven Retry Storm

From last Tuesday's outage: the Spoolhaven print service retried failed jobs without backoff, saturating the render pool. Fix merged; retries now use capped exponential backoff with jitter. Owner will monitor for a week before closing. The agreed retry constants are recorded below.

constants for yadup-kajof:
RATE_LIMITS = {
    "zorwyn": 1,
    "druwyn": 1,
}